N2 - The article is dedicated to the memory of the well-known social, political and church figure, Archpriest Kassian Bohatyrets, one of the leaders of the Old-Rusin party in Austrian Bukovina. During the Second Political Trial of Vienna in 1916 he was sentenced to death for his conviction. In the last years of his life Father Kassian compiled a history of the Orthodox Church in Bukovina «The History of the Bukovinian Diocese from the Earliest Times to 1943». This history also included the history of the land. Describing the period of Austrian dominance Father Kassian also gives note to the socio-political situation and the persecution of the patriots of Holy Rus' by the Austrian authorities. He sheds light on the church-religious life in Bukovina during WWI, the oppression by the Austrian authorities of the Orthodox clergy for their sympathy towards Russia.
